Another good proof: Take any arbitrary rectangle. Find it's center. By definition, all 4 corners will be the same distance from the center. That means a circle can be draw with the same center, passing thru all 4 corners. Now the corners of a rectangle are 90°. Diagonals of the rectangle are also diameters of the circle, so 2 opposite corners form AB, while either of the other corners is P, as per Eddie's diagram.

You can also reverse it, taking Eddies diagram and extending PO to Q of the far side, forming 2 crossed diagonals, which also define a rectangle.
